In Sumy region, detectives from the National Anti-Corruption Bureau (NABU) and the Specialized Anti-Corruption Prosecutor's Office (SAP) reported suspicions to Mykola Zadorozhny, a deputy from the Servant of the People party and a member of the parliamentary budget committee.
He was accused of extorting a bribe of 3.4 million hryvnias for not interfering with repair work on a water supply system in the Okhtyrsky district.
Mykola Zadorozhny has already been expelled from the temporary investigative commission he heads on the issues of the construction of fortifications and the purchase of drones, and his membership in the Servant of the People faction has been temporarily suspended.
